MENU
ACCOUNT
VEHICLES
CART
Getting Search Results .... Please Wait
3 Door Van - Commercial
Townace
CR51R
CR51
11/1996 - 12/1998
4WD
Auto/Manual
Diesel
2.0 Litre
4 Cylinder
2C
Cam:SOHC 8v
Size:1974cc
Diesel Inj
Built In:
JAPAN